Our client is an innovative manufacturing company that is looking for individuals with a passion for personal and professional development. As part of their team, you will have the opportunity to work on exciting projects, collaborate with talented individuals, and make a real impact on their business.

Your main responsibilities will be:

  • Manage projects from start through to handover which includes but not limited to Layout preparation, equipment commissioning & supporting documentation.
  • With the use of CIP & LEAN principles identify ways to reduce production costs, improve efficiencies and yield.
  • You will provide day to day support to production leaders.
  • Proactive problem-solving support of reoccurring productions issues including downtime, performance and quality issues using various problem-solving techniques eg; 5Y's, Fishbone, 8D's, etc.
  • Work closely with inter departments eg; supply chain, production and technical team to enable continuous improvement of all performance & quality related KPI's in line with the company objectives.

What you will need to succeed:

  • You will have a good understanding of OEE, BOM's, Project management
  • Good understanding of Lean Manufacturing methodologies ie: VSM, 5S, 8 wastes
  • Excellent written and verbal communication
  • Be able to manage change effectively
  • You will be a self-starter and react well to change in a fast-paced environment
